CAR Moves Ahead Despite COVID-19 The show must go on. Despite fears over COVID-19, the disease caused by a new coronavirus, the 25th anniversary of the Conference of Automotive Remarketing in Las Vegas on March 24-25 was expected to go forward at press time. The event took a hit when KAR Auction Services and Manheim announced that because of companywide travel restrictions, they will not be attending. CAR still features a packed lineup including the top names and companies in remarketing, The conference is held in conjunction with the International Automotive Remarkerters Alliance and the National Auto Auction Association. The IARA kicks off the two-day event with keynote speaker Cedric King, a retired Master Sergeant of the U.S. Army, who received a Bronze Star, Purple Heart and the Meritorious Service Medal. In 2012, during his second tour of Afghanistan, he suffered life-threatening injuries due to an improvised explosive device, leading to the amputation of both legs. Just 21 months after his doubleamputation, the former Army Ranger completed the Boston Marathon on prosthetic blades. He has since gone on to complete in the Ironman Triathlon, New York marathon and other endurance events. Another keynoter at CAR is Melinda Zabritski, senior director for Experian Automotive, where she serves as the company’s primary analyst and spokesperson regarding key automotive finance trends. Scott Stratten, president of UnMarketing, a firm that has worked for PepsiCo, Microsoft, Fidelity and
Century21, will also give a keynote address. Other sessions will also include people ranging from Darrin Aiken of Wheels Inc. and Debbie Boyce of LeasePlan, to auction veterans Jeff Barber of State Line Auto Auction and National Auto Auction Association President Laura Taylor, among others. CAR organizers said in a state-
ment they have taken precautions to keep attendees safe. “We are adhering to the suggestions of the U.S. and state public health guidelines as they are developing with regards to the COVID-19 virus. As the COVID-19 situation is evolving, we strongly advise that all exhibitors and visitors review, from the most trusted source, the
U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) travel health notices related to this outbreak. As a precaution, we are implementing
a range of additional hygiene measures at our events from increased cleaning and disinfection across all high-volume touchpoints and availability of sanitizing and disinfection materials for public use, to onsite emergency medical personnel.” Organizers are discouraging anyone who has flu-like symptoms from attending. CAR is restricting attendance for those who have recently visited China, Italy, UK, UAE, Iran, South Korea and Hong Kong, based on the State Department guidelines.
